Awards Program
IAAO's
Awards Program boasts categories recognizing individual and
organizational achievements in numerous areas including publications,
technical expertise, and service to IAAO, just to name a few.
Nominations are accepted at the beginning of each year through May 1.
Award
winners are announced and recognized at the IAAO Annual Conference. The
annual Awards Program is a highly visible conference event and all IAAO
members and affiliated organizations are encouraged to submit
nominations.

Fellows Program
The
IAAO Fellows Program recognizes individuals who have dedicated their
career to the development of our profession and made exceptional
contributions to the Association and the assessment industry. The FIAAO
title is awarded at the Annual Conference to recognize the best of the
best within our ranks.
